Ingredients
- 1 cup olive oil or canola oil or any oil used on salads (salad oils)
- 1 cup finely chopped celery
- 1 cup finely chopped green pepper
- 2 cups finely chopped onion
- 2 tablespoons minced garlic
- 13 cups crushed tomatoes
- 1 cup tomato puree
- 1 teaspoon sweet basil, crushed
- 1 - bay leaf
- 1 tablespoon sugar
- - salt and pepper to taste
How To Make the greenbriar spaghetti sauce (dad's recipe)
-
Step 1Saute onions, celery and green pepper in salad oil, stirring frequently. Add garlic, cook 2 minutes longer.
-
Step 2Add tomatoes, puree and seasonings.
-
Step 3Simmer uncovered about 2 hours.
-
Step 4After it has simmered, fill clean sterilized jars to within 1 inch of top of jar. Put on cap, screw the band 'fingertip' tight. Too tight and air bubbles may not be able to escape while boiling or canning.
-
Step 5Process for 45 minutes for quart jars, and 35 minutes for pint jars, in a water bath. Process 35 minutes for pints. Process 45 minutes for quarts. Remove from canner. Let cool in draft-free area (cover with towels to be sure) Check lids to be sure they are sealed. (Press center of lid with your finger. If it moves and makes a "click", the jar is not sealed.)
-
Step 6Note: Ground beef, mushrooms, etc., can be added at time of use.
-
Step 7Note: if you do not wish to can this sauce, it can also be frozen for up to six months inside freezer.
